In the Peru membrane filtration market, one of the key challenges is the high initial investment required for setting up membrane filtration systems. This cost includes purchasing the necessary equipment, installation, and maintenance expenses. Additionally, the lack of awareness and technical expertise among end-users regarding membrane filtration technologies poses a challenge to market growth. Another significant issue is the limited availability of skilled professionals to operate and maintain these systems effectively. Furthermore, regulatory constraints and environmental concerns related to the disposal of membrane filtration waste products also impact the market. Overcoming these challenges will require industry players to focus on educating customers, investing in training programs, and developing cost-effective solutions to make membrane filtration more accessible and sustainable in Peru.

The Peruvian government has implemented various policies related to the membrane filtration market to promote sustainable water management and environmental protection. These policies include the National Water Resources Policy, which aims to ensure the efficient and equitable use of water resources, and the National Plan for Water Supply and Sanitation Services, which focuses on improving access to clean water and sanitation facilities. Additionally, the government has established regulatory frameworks such as the General Law on the Environment and the Environmental Impact Assessment system to monitor and regulate the impact of membrane filtration projects on the environment. These policies create a supportive regulatory environment for the membrane filtration market in Peru, encouraging investment and innovation in water treatment technologies.
